TODAY is Thursday, December 1, the 335th day of 2016. There are 30 days left in the year. Highlights in history on this date: 1958 – The Central African Republic attains self-rule within the

French Union. 1959 – Cold War: Opening date for signature of the Antarctic Treaty, which sets aside Antarctica as a scientific preserve and bans military activity on the continent. 1969 – Vietnam War: The first draft lottery in the United

States is held since World War II. 1971 – Cambodian Civil War: Khmer Rouge rebels intensify assaults on Cambodian government positions, forcing their retreat from Kompong Thmar and nearby Ba Ray. 1973 – Papua New Guinea gains self-governance from

Australia. 1974 – TWA Flight 514, a Boeing 727, crashes northwest of Dulles Internatio­nal Airport, killing all 92 people on board. 1974 – Northwest Orient Airlines Flight 6231, another Boeing 727, crashes northwest of John F. Kennedy Internatio­nal Airport. 1981 – Inex-Adria Aviopromet Flight 1308, a McDonnell Douglas MD-80, crashes in Corsica, killing all 180 people on board. 1984 – NASA conducts the Controlled Impact Demonstrat­ion, wherein an airliner is deliberate­ly crashed in order to test technologi­es and gather data to help improve survivabil­ity of crashes. 1988 – Benazir Bhutto is appointed Prime Minister of Pakistan. 1989 – Philippine coup attempt: The right-wing military rebel Reform the Armed Forces Movement attempts to oust Philippine President Corazon Aquino in a failed bloody coup d’état. 1989 – Cold War: East Germany’s parliament abolishes the constituti­onal provision granting the Communist Party the leading role in the state. 1990 – Channel Tunnel sections started from the United Kingdom and France meet 40 metres beneath the seabed. 1991 – Cold War: Ukrainian voters overwhelmi­ngly approve a

referendum for independen­ce from the Soviet Union. 1997 – In the Indian state of Bihar, Ranvir Sena attacked the CPI(ML) Party Unity stronghold Lakshmanpu­r-Bathe, killing 63 lower caste people. 2013 – China launches Yutu or Jade Rabbit, its first lunar rover, as part of the Chang’e 3 lunar exploratio­n mission.
